当前位置:首页 > 前沿科技 > 正文

编程中的RED,探索其重要性与实际应用-

在编程的世界里,RED不仅仅代表红色,它更是一种重要的编程理念和工具,我们将探讨编程中RED的重要性,以及它在编程实践中的具体应用。

编程中的RED:初识与理解

在编程领域,RED通常指的是“Redundancy Error Detection”(冗余错误检测)的缩写,在编程过程中,由于各种原因(如代码错误、数据传输错误等),可能会导致程序出现错误或异常,为了及时发现并纠正这些错误,程序员需要借助各种工具和技术来检测和修复这些错误,而RED正是其中一种重要的技术手段。

RED在编程中的重要性

1、提高程序稳定性:通过RED技术,程序员可以及时发现并纠正程序中的错误,从而避免因错误导致的程序崩溃或数据丢失等问题,提高程序的稳定性。

2、保障数据安全:在数据处理和传输过程中,RED技术可以帮助检测和纠正数据错误,保障数据的完整性和准确性,从而避免因数据错误导致的严重后果。

3、提升开发效率:通过RED技术,程序员可以快速定位并修复程序中的错误,缩短开发周期,提高开发效率。

编程中的RED,探索其重要性与实际应用-  第1张

RED在编程中的具体应用

1、编译器与解释器中的RED应用

在编程语言的编译和解释过程中,编译器和解释器会利用RED技术来检测源代码或解释过程中的错误,编译器会通过语法分析、语义分析等手段来检测源代码中的错误,并通过RED技术来确保编译出的目标代码的准确性,解释器则会在解释执行过程中实时检测并纠正错误。

2、数据传输中的RED应用

在数据传输过程中,由于网络延迟、信道干扰等原因,可能会导致数据传输错误,为了保障数据传输的准确性,通常会采用RED技术来检测数据传输过程中的错误,在网络通信中,可以通过CRC(循环冗余校验)等算法来检测数据包的错误,一旦发现错误,可以及时进行重传或纠正。

3、存储系统中的RED应用

在存储系统中,RED技术也被广泛应用,在RAID(独立磁盘冗余阵列)技术中,通过将数据分散存储在多个磁盘上,并采用一定的冗余技术来保护数据,一旦某个磁盘出现故障,可以通过其他磁盘上的冗余数据来恢复丢失的数据,从而保障数据的可靠性和完整性。

RED技术的发展趋势

随着编程技术的不断发展和进步,RED技术也在不断发展和完善,RED技术将更加智能化和自动化,能够更好地适应各种复杂的编程环境和需求,随着人工智能、机器学习等技术的不断发展,RED技术也将与这些技术相结合,实现更加高效和准确的错误检测和修复。

编程中的RED是一种重要的编程理念和技术手段,它可以帮助程序员及时发现并纠正程序中的错误,提高程序的稳定性和数据安全性,在编程实践中,RED技术被广泛应用于编译器、解释器、数据传输和存储系统等领域,随着技术的不断发展和进步,RED技术将更加智能化和自动化,为编程领域的发展提供更加有力的支持。

掌握RED技术对于程序员来说是非常重要的,通过学习和应用RED技术,程序员可以更好地保障程序的稳定性和数据安全性,提高开发效率和质量,随着技术的不断发展和进步,我们也期待看到更多创新和应用场景的出现。